Requirements
  • Collaborative mindset
  • Excellent technical writing, presentation, and interpersonal communication skills
  • Passion for learning and problem solving
  • BS, MS, or PhD in engineering or a related technical degree
  • 5+ years experience as System Safety Engineer
  • Experience with all types of systems commonly used on civil aircraft, in particular Flight Controls and Powertrain systems
  • Experience with all phases of aircraft development from concept to entry into service
  • Experience performing all types of safety analyses commonly used in civil aviation
  • Experience creating, validating, and verifying aircraft and system-level safety requirements
  • Experience being personally accountable for one or more safety activities on a civil aircraft certification program
  • Experience developing and executing test plans in a simulation environment
  • Detailed understanding of civil aviation standards, practices, and regulations
Responsibilities
  • Collaborate with various engineering disciplines to design high-reliability, safety-critical systems for an electric vertical takeoff and landing (eVTOL) aircraft
  • Take ownership of the safety requirements and safety assessments of one or more vehicle systems, including Flight Controls and Powertrain systems
  • Participate in or perform one or more vehicle-level installation safety or other common cause analyses
  • Participate in the definition of safety requirements and safety assessments at the vehicle level
  • Represent System Safety in multi-disciplinary decision making and regulatory compliance activities under supervision of leadership
  • Contribute to the System Safety processes and work methods
  • Participate in regulatory compliance planning and demonstration activities under supervision of team leadership and the Certification and Test organization
  • Develop and execute test plans in a simulation lab environment
  • Perform Zonal Safety Inspections in the aircraft
Desired Qualifications
  • Experience with NX, Solidworks, CATIA, or similar CAD tool, for conducting drawing and 3D model reviews
  • Experience conducting physical aircraft installation examination and inspections
  • Experience working on type certification of an aircraft from start to finish under 14 CFR Part 23 or Part 27
  • Worked on different phases of ARP4754A development programs
  • Worked on Flight Controls or Powertrain systems (electric engines, high voltage power systems) in automotive or equivalent industry

Archer designs and develops electric vertical takeoff and landing (eVTOL) aircraft aimed at transforming urban transportation. Their aircraft operate by taking off and landing vertically, which allows them to navigate congested city environments efficiently. Archer targets urban commuters, city planners, and transportation networks, offering eco-friendly solutions to improve urban mobility. Unlike traditional transportation methods, Archer's eVTOLs provide a sustainable alternative that reduces environmental impact. The company generates revenue through the sale of its aircraft and may also offer air taxi services in the future. Archer's goal is to lead the shift towards sustainable air mobility in cities, making urban commuting more efficient and environmentally friendly.

Archer Aviation raises $850M in funding

Archer Aviation's shares fell 14.1% to $10.08 premarket after announcing an $850 million direct stock deal. The company sold 85 million shares at $10 each, a 14.7% discount to the last close. This raises Archer's total liquidity to approximately $2 billion. The funds will be used for general purposes, focusing on commercial capabilities and AI-based aviation software. Archer has a market cap of $6.4 billion and is rated "buy" by 7 of 9 analysts, with a median price target of $13.
